Job summary

Westchester Medical Center Health Network is seeking an experienced Senior Inpatient Coder to address insurance denials and code complex records using ICD-10-CM/PCS. The role includes providing technical guidance and leading coding activities in collaboration with hospital staff.

The ideal candidate holds a CCS certification, minimum three years in inpatient acute care coding, and strong knowledge of AHA guidelines.

Qualifications

  • Minimum of three years in inpatient coding in acute care.
  • Proficient in ICD-10-CM and ICD-10-PCS coding.
  • Pass coding assessment before hire.
  • Current CCS certification required; RHIA/RHIT preferred.
  • Ability to train junior coders and guide others.

Responsibilities

  • Addresses appeals to insurance denials to facilitate expedient resolution and reimbursement.
  • Interprets and applies AHA guidelines to support diagnoses and procedures.
  • Analyzes patterns in coding errors and reports to leadership.
  • Participates in mandated medical record review processes.
  • Assigns and records accurate codes for diagnoses and procedures as documented by the attending physician.
  • Queries physicians for documentation clarification.
  • Ensures factors for DRG assignment are present and diagnoses ranked properly.
  • Contacts to obtain clarifications.
  • Compiles and updates the appeal log detailing denials, hospital's reply, and follow-up responses.
  • Provides information to staff regarding documentation and DRGs.
  • Abstracts information to compile reports.
  • May train lower level coders and provide guidance.
  • Resolves bill holds to maintain DNFB and coding queue.
  • Acts as liaison between Patient Accounting and Coding.
